使用Python对MySQL数据库的操作指南:社区版与专业版PyCharm的应用
使用Python操作MySQL数据库需要以下主要步骤:设置环境、建立连接、执行SQL操作。通过PyCharm(无论是社区版还是专业版)来实现这些操作是非常方便的。以下是详细指南:
环境准备
安装MySQL Server
- 首先,需要在本地或服务器上安装MySQL Server。
Python环境
- 安装 Python,如果尚未安装,可以从 Python官网 下载并安装。
安装MySQL连接器
- 使用
pip
来安装连接器库:
pip install mysql-connector-python
mysql-connector-python
是用于连接MySQL的官方Python库。
- 使用
在PyCharm中设置项目
安装PyCharm
- 下载并安装 PyCharm 社区版或专业版:JetBrains官网
创建Python项目
- 打开PyCharm并创建一个新项目。
设置Python解释器
- 确保为项目选择正确的Python解释器。
- 转到
File -> Settings -> Project: [YourProjectName] -> Python Interpreter
- 添加并选择您之前安装的Python版本。
编写Python代码访问MySQL
导入库
import mysql.connector
建立连接
conn = mysql.connector.connect(
host="localhost", # 数据库服务器地址
user="yourusername", # 数据库用户名
password="yourpassword", # 数据库密码
database="yourdatabase" # 数据库名称
)
创建游标以执行SQL语句
cursor = conn.cursor()
执行SQL查询
# 示例:创建表
cursor.execute("CREATE TABLE IF NOT EXISTS test (id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(255))")
# 示例:插入数据
cursor.execute("INSERT INTO test (name) VALUES ('John')")
conn.commit() # 提交更改
读取数据
cursor.execute("SELECT * FROM test")
result = cursor.fetchall()
for row in result:
print(row)
关闭连接
cursor.close()
conn.close()
使用PyCharm的高级功能(专业版独有功能)
数据库工具和SQL支持
- 在PyCharm专业版中,可以使用内置的数据库工具来更加方便地查看和管理数据库。
- 通过
View -> Tool Windows -> Database
打开数据库窗口。 - 配置数据库连接以使用GUI浏览、编辑数据库结构和数据。
SQL代码洞察
- 在Python代码中编写SQL语句时,PyCharm专业版可以提供智能的SQL代码补全和检查。
这些步骤可以帮助您在PyCharm中有效地使用Python连接和操作MySQL数据库。对于社区版,虽然缺乏专门的数据库工具,但编写和运行代码的核心功能是完全具备的。